Equipment malfunction can cause significant disruptions in operations, leading to costly downtime and safety risks. Conducting a thorough root cause analysis is essential to uncover the underlying issues causing equipment failures and to develop effective, long-term solutions.
This Equipment Malfunction Root Cause Analysis Template provides a structured approach to dissecting equipment issues. With this template, maintenance teams can:
- Collect detailed data from equipment logs, operator reports, and inspection records
- Visualize failure patterns and contributing factors
- Apply the 5 Whys technique to drill down to the fundamental cause
- Develop targeted corrective actions and preventive maintenance plans
